Kalahari Resorts & Conventions delivers a waterpark resort and conference experience all under one roof. The authentically African-themed resort is home to America’s largest indoor waterparks and features well-appointed guest rooms, full-service Spa Kalahari, a fun-filled family entertainment center, on-site signature restaurants, unique retail shops and a state-of-the-art convention center.
We are inviting you to apply for the Audio-Visual Tech position. In this role, you will provide setup of all functions that require audio visual equipment. To ensure accurate tracking of equipment, protecting and caring for assets and serve as a consultant for sales regarding audio visual needs of future bookings. They will assist the Banquet Team to operate in a “for-profit” environment as well as ensure guest service is beyond expectations so that the Resort will meet and/or exceed budgeted expectations.
We require that you have background, consisting of prior experience as an audio technician is preferred. Prior experience in a banquet position and have abroad understanding of the tourism industry and the day-to-day operations of a hotel/resort and convention center operations are helpful.
